Maintenance

A pod-based coffee maker offers numerous advantages over the traditional coffee maker. A pod coffee maker can, for instance, reduce waste, while the brewing process is easy and efficient. A pod coffee machine (read full article) requires to be cleaned and descaled regularly in order to achieve the most effective results. Moreover, the device requires a water reservoir and a drip tray to function effectively. Rinse the drip tray and reservoir with clean water each time you use your coffee maker. This will keep your coffee machine clear and avoid the buildup of grime.

A clean pod coffee machine is also more hygiene-friendly than one that is filthy. You should empty the capsules that are used and the receptacle where they fall, and wash the inside of the machine regularly. It is also important to descale the machine regularly to remove mineral deposits. Ideally, you should do this every three months.

Certain pod coffee machines come with a built-in automatic descaling system, which is a convenient way to remove deposits. This system may not work as well as it should, and could leave traces of residues behind in the machine. Pour distilled white vinegar into the reservoir of water for a coffee maker that does not have an descaling solution. This will get rid of the buildup of limescale and other deposits that are present in the coffee maker.
